HC Deb 10 February 1988 vol 127 c270W
Mr. David Martin

To ask the Secretary of State for Social Services how many patients received in-patient care and attended out-patient clinics for mental illness at St. James's hospital, Portsmouth, for the latest two years available.

Mrs. Currie

The table shows the information available centrally on admissions and attendances at St. James's hospital and its subsidiary units. A patient may be readmitted or attend an out-patient clinic a number of times in any year.

1985 1986
Number of admissions, for mental illness 1,766 1,609
Number of attendances to out-patient clinics conducted by psychiatric medical staff 11,547 10,469
